Implementing Comprehensive Security Solutions
Implementing comprehensive security solutions is a pivotal role for IT consultants. This involves deploying a combination of hardware and software solutions designed to protect an organization's data. Firewalls, intrusion detection systems, and encryption protocols are just a few examples of technologies used to fortify defenses against cyber attacks.
Additionally, IT consultants play a critical role in developing incident response plans. These plans outline the steps to be taken in the event of a security breach, ensuring that companies can swiftly contain and recover from cyber incidents. Effective incident response plans are essential for minimizing downtime and reducing financial losses associated with cyber attacks.

The Role of Compliance and Regulations
Compliance with cybersecurity regulations is another vital aspect of modern IT consulting. Governments around the world have enacted various laws and regulations to protect sensitive data and ensure companies follow best security practices. IT consultants must guide their clients through the complex landscape of regulatory compliance, helping them understand and adhere to relevant standards such as GDPR, HIPAA, or PCI DSS.
Failure to comply with these regulations can result in severe penalties, including fines and legal actions. Therefore, IT consultants must ensure that their clients' cybersecurity measures align with legal requirements, thereby safeguarding them from potential liabilities.
